Output 6c8fbde7b2e42e5bab5b2cc2af1644ecf40bd661b1d3c98b73bf81ef67b976c9:0

value
407372118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a03b2c9972685898219a6522ecd28e00c615225a OP_EQUAL
address
3GJEvjUvrQGMXn9buBUfPQbsuqqTrvAEuS
transaction
6c8fbde7b2e42e5bab5b2cc2af1644ecf40bd661b1d3c98b73bf81ef67b976c9
confirmations
537584
spent
true